Redhill Farm Free Range Pork

Farm shop

Selling: Cheese / Dairy, Drinks, Meats, Preserves

Redhill Farm produces award-winning free-range pork from their own herd and use traditional, simple methods to make fine quality dry-cured hams and bacon, handmade sausages and pork pies. These are all available from the farm shop, farmers' markets around the Lincolnshire area and by mail order: give them a call or pick up a leaflet.
